Driver from viral Palisades Parkway road-rage crash slapped with summonses

The driving force of automobile that’s seen in a viral video of a dramatic road-rage crash on the Palisades Parkway was handled for minor accidents and slapped with summonses, cops mentioned.

Stony Level resident Michael Brabham, 27, was taken to an area hospital for remedy and ticketed for reckless driving and weaving in visitors, mentioned Raymond Walter, detective sergeant top notch with the Palisades Interstate Parkway Police.

Wild dashcam video of Brabham in a 2012 Honda Accord tailgating a Ford F-150 was shot close to Exit 4 in Alpine, NJ simply earlier than 4:40 p.m. on Jan. 24, Walter mentioned.

The video exhibits the Accord because it veers to the best onto the shoulder. The driving force then tries to squeeze in between the Ford and one other car however the Honda loses management and veers right into a rock formation on the northbound facet of the parkway, then flips and overturns.

“Hopefully this video teaches different drivers, that driving aggressively or recklessly can have extreme penalties,” Walter instructed The Publish in an e-mail. “Fortunately on this explicit crash there have been no life threatening accidents.”

Brabham admitted the accident was induced “by having a street rage incident with one other car,” Walter mentioned. The video was offered to police for overview, he added.
